基于弯道二次流修正模型的大辽河潮流界时空变化模拟

摘    要:基于ELADI算法的平面二维水环境模型WESC2D,定量研究大辽河潮区界与潮流界的时空变化规律。在模拟和验证大辽河潮位变化过程基础上,通过数值试验系统地模拟分析了上游径流量及汇流比、下游潮差和海平面上升对大辽河潮区界与潮流界的影响规律,并以1999年—2009年水文过程为条件定量研究大辽河潮流界的年、月变化及潮流界位置出现频率。结果表明,径流是影响大辽河潮区界与潮流界位置的主要因素,大辽河潮流界远远超过三岔河。

关 键 词:潮区界  潮流界  大辽河  ELADI  WESC2D

Spatio-temporal Characteristics of Tidal Limit and Tidal Current Limit of Daliaohe River Based on a Modified Model

Abstract:In this paper ,temporal and spatial variation of tidal limit and tidal current limit in Daliaohe River was quanti-tatively analyzed by a new two-dimensional water environment model based on the Eulerian-Lagrangian alternating direc-tion implicit method .With the effects of upstream runoff and discharge ratio ,downstream tidal range and sea level rise on tidal limit and tidal current limit as well as annual and monthly changes and occurrence frequency of tidal current limit in Daliaohe River under the condition of hydrological processes during 1999 and 2009 were numerically simulated and quan-titatively analyzed .The results show that runoff is the major factor affecting the location of tidal limit and tidal current limit of Daliaohe River .
Keywords:tidal limit  tidal current limit  Daliaohe River  Eulerian-Lagrangian alternating direction implicit
